Estimated auto insurance rates for a Chevrolet Bolt EUV are $1,588 annually for full coverage insurance. Comprehensive insurance costs around $260, collision costs $466, and liability coverage is $624. Liability-only insurance costs around $710 a year, with high-risk driver insurance costing $3,436 or more. Teenage drivers pay the most at $6,286 a year or more.

Estimates include $500 deductible amounts, bodily injury liability limits of 30/60, and includes uninsured motorist and medical coverage. Rates include averaging for all 50 states and for different Bolt EUV trim levels.

Insurance prices for a Chevrolet Bolt EUV also have a wide range based on the model of your Bolt EUV, your risk profile, and deductibles and policy limits.

An older driver with no violations or accidents and high physical damage deductibles may only pay around $1,500 every 12 months on average, or $125 per month, for full coverage. Prices are much higher for drivers in their teens, where even without any violations or accidents they should be prepared to pay as much as $6,200 a year. View Rates by Age

If you have a few violations or you caused a few accidents, you are probably paying at least $1,900 to $2,700 additional annually, depending on your age. High-risk driver insurance is expensive and can cost around 43% to 133% more than a normal policy. View High Risk Driver Rates

Using high physical damage deductibles can reduce prices by up to $490 a year, while increasing your policy's liability limits will increase prices. Switching from a 50/100 bodily injury limit to a 250/500 limit will cost up to $561 more each year. View Rates by Deductible or Liability Limit

Where you choose to live also has a big influence on Chevrolet Bolt EUV insurance rates. A middle-age driver might find prices as low as $1,040 a year in states like Vermont, Wisconsin, and North Carolina, or be forced to pay as much as $2,140 on average in Michigan, New York, and Florida.

How to Buy Low Cost Chevrolet Bolt EUV Insurance

Finding better rates on auto insurance consists of having a good driving record, having good credit, paying for small claims out-of-pocket, and taking advantage of discounts. Invest time comparing rates every other policy renewal by getting quotes from direct insurance companies, and also from several local insurance agents.
